I set the Zwift difficulty at ~85% on my Direto, based on the turbo being able to emulate up to 14% and Zwift hitting 17%.
On the radio tower final climb, it means I'm using my easiest gears.
Don’t understand 85% does that mean you’re getting 15% power for free ??
not really tiger - more that the hills feel a bit easier but your power still is only whatever your body produces and your avatar's speed is dependent on that (it's really just like using an easier gear on a hill - you still have to get up it and you'd have to spin faster to achieve the same speed)
For me if I want to grind up a 17% slope like in real life I'll just run a bigger gear. I'd quite like the ability to spin up them otherwise I'd probably find myself avoiding the radio mast climb.

Anyone know the best route to get an "accurate" FPT test on, I think it could be slightly exaggerated if i performed the test on a super hilly route.
Have my ftp test tonight after the 4wk training workout. Was previously 214 after a race jumped it up from 160ish. My 10 minute free ride best effort was around 250 a couple of days ago and that felt quite easy, will see how things go tonight!
Anyone know the best route to get an “accurate” FPT test on, I think it could be slightly exaggerated if i performed the test on a super hilly route.
Select the FTP tests workout in the starting menu. This makes the terrain irrelevant so you can just concentrate on putting out the power. It'll also give a good warmup ready for the full 20 min test. The whole workout will take about an hour
